What is Creatine and How Does it Work?

Creatine is a substance found naturally in your muscle cells, synthesized from the amino acids arginine, glycine, and methionine in the liver and kidneys. The body converts creatine into phosphocreatine, which is stored in muscles and used to rapidly generate adenosine triphosphate (ATP), the primary energy currency for cellular function. This enhanced energy production is especially critical during short, high-intensity activities like weightlifting and sprinting.

While the body produces some creatine and we can get it from foods like red meat and fish, natural production and dietary intake often only fill muscle creatine stores to 60-80% capacity. Supplementation, most commonly with creatine monohydrate, is the most efficient way to maximize these stores by an additional 20-40%.

The Role of Creatine in Energy and Performance

When you engage in explosive, high-intensity exercise, your body uses its limited ATP stores quickly. The phosphocreatine reserves in your muscles rapidly replenish ATP, allowing you to perform for longer before fatiguing. This translates to more reps, heavier weights, and overall improved athletic performance over time, which fuels muscle growth. Creatine also draws water into muscle cells, a process called cell volumization, which can increase protein synthesis and contribute to muscle fullness and size.

Signs You Might Benefit from Creatine Supplementation

Assessing your need for creatine doesn't require complex medical tests for most healthy individuals. Instead, it involves a self-evaluation of your fitness goals, training progress, and dietary habits. Here are several indicators that may suggest you could benefit from a supplement:

  • You've Hit a Training Plateau: If you've been consistently training but have stopped seeing progress in your strength or power output, creatine can be a powerful tool to help you break through that plateau. The extra boost of ATP allows you to push through those last few reps or sets that lead to new gains.
  • Your Recovery is Lagging: Slower-than-usual recovery between workouts can be a sign that your body's energy reserves are depleted. Creatine has been shown to help reduce muscle damage and inflammation, speeding up the recovery process.
  • You Follow a Vegetarian or Vegan Diet: Since creatine is found almost exclusively in animal products, vegetarians and vegans have naturally lower muscle creatine levels. Supplementation can significantly increase their creatine stores, and some studies suggest they may see even more pronounced effects on performance and muscle gain than meat-eaters.
  • You Engage in High-Intensity, Short-Duration Sports: Creatine's primary mechanism of action—providing rapid energy—makes it ideal for athletes in sports requiring repeated bursts of power. This includes weightlifters, bodybuilders, powerlifters, sprinters, and those in team sports like football or hockey.
  • You Are an Older Adult Concerned with Muscle Loss: As we age, muscle mass and strength naturally decline, a condition known as sarcopenia. Studies have shown that older adults who combine resistance training with creatine supplementation experience greater improvements in muscle mass and strength compared to exercise alone.

Objective Ways to Measure Creatine's Effectiveness

For those who decide to start supplementing, tracking objective metrics can confirm if it's working for you:

  • Performance Metrics: Keep a training log of the weight you lift, the number of repetitions you complete, and the speed of your sprints. Any consistent increases in these areas after starting supplementation can indicate effectiveness.
  • Body Composition Analysis: Monitoring changes in your lean body mass using a body composition scale or other methods can reveal muscle growth attributable to creatine use.
  • Subjective Feedback: Pay attention to how you feel during workouts. Increased energy, greater muscle fullness, and faster recovery are all positive signs.

Important Considerations and Potential Side Effects

While creatine is one of the most well-research supplements and is considered safe for most healthy adults, it is not without considerations. Consulting a healthcare professional before starting any new supplement is always recommended, especially if you have pre-existing health conditions. Cleveland Clinic provides extensive information on its safety and usage.

Some potential side effects include:

  • Water Retention: Creatine pulls water into your muscles, which can cause an initial weight gain. This is not fat gain but rather water weight within the muscle cells.
  • Gastrointestinal Distress: Mild issues like stomach cramps, bloating, or diarrhea can occur. Splitting doses or forgoing the loading phase can help.
  • Kidney or Liver Concerns: The misconception that creatine harms the kidneys stems from its metabolic byproduct, creatinine. For healthy individuals, the kidneys effectively process this. However, those with pre-existing kidney or liver disease should avoid creatine or use it under a doctor's supervision.
